Trenton, FL

Thriving overall. Population is the clearest support signal, while jobs needs the most attention. Housing reads as affordable for a median-income household.

housing affordability breakdown

Cost of Living

Median household income$49,350/yr
Median rent$927/mo
Rent share of income22.5%
Est. mortgage (30yr, 6.5%)$11,135/yr
Mortgage share of income22.6%

Rent data from Census ACS 5-year. Mortgage estimate assumes 20% down, 6.5% APR, 30-year fixed.
